Micro data centers

Compact, repeatable, distributed micro data centers.

Cloud Wash Laundry focuses on smaller, repeatable deployments rather than giant greenfield builds, aiming to lower infrastructure friction and shorten deployment paths.

Why this approach

  • Uses existing facilities rather than waiting for large new campuses.
  • Puts compute near customers and real-world demand centers.
  • Allows staged growth across many markets instead of a single mega-build.
  • Makes heat reuse practical because thermal loads are colocated with compute.
  • Creates more optionality for local partners and franchisees.
